Output cce538f5421deaf61e16446437b2f8581ff92bd2d6036997253d0d48dfee8146:2

value
29690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c2ac569ae0a1dacf9a01d1a921a800b3fb4a1e OP_EQUAL
address
37sJQXXoDMFgEFPpmn877j279rvmBk8eZP
transaction
cce538f5421deaf61e16446437b2f8581ff92bd2d6036997253d0d48dfee8146
confirmations
260536
spent
true